I got the bike from a friend of mine, James , 77 years old, he bought it brand new in the early 70`s he dosen`t remember if it was for him or his kids ,at that time he was a pilot for United Airline, that`s what attracted him to buy the bike since he was made of aerospace grade metal . He says it was very expensive !
Anyway, for unknown reasons he never tried it or used the bike ,he stored it in is garage in Palmdale ,CA , near the Mojave desert, were it remained for 40 years .
He recently decided to clean the garage and wanted to thrown it away but give it to me !! And this is how I got the bike!
It is now sitting in my living room and it is for sale ,it is brand new ,never used ! near showroom condition !
